PCUNZIP.COM Version 1.0 ------------------------------------------------------------------------ Michael Mefford March 31, 1992 (Utilities) ------------------------------------------------------------------------ Purpose: Provides a smaller, no-cost alternative to the shareware utility PKUNZIP.EXE for decompressing .ZIP files downloaded from PC MagNet and elsewhere. Format: pcunzip filename [\path] [/V] [/E] [/O] [/?] Remarks: Entered simply with a filename (adding the .ZIP extension is unnecessary), PCUNZIP uncompresses all files within a .ZIP file into the current directory. A path to an existing subdirectory can be supplied if it is desired to store the decompressed file(s) elsewhere. The optional /V (view) switch can be supplied to display a listing of the files contained in a given .ZIP filename. The /E (extract) switch, followed by the name of one of these contained files, will extract and decompress only the named file. By default, PCUNZIP issues a confirming prompt before overwriting a same-named file in the target subdirectory. This warning can be overridden by executing PCUNZIP with the /O switch. PCUNZIP and its /V and /E options support the use of the DOS * and ? wildcards. This enables viewing or extracting all or only the similarly named files for a C program, for example. Unlike the full PKUNZIP utility, however, PCUNZIP does not support the decompression of encrypted files. Updated versions of PCUNZIP will be made available for download to reflect any changes to the PKZIP program implemented in files on PC MagNet. PCUNZIP requires 5K of storage space and 100K of working memory while active.
